0

ホーム フォルダーの割り当てと割り当てワークスペースに 2 つのディレクトリがあります。同じリポジトリで管理したいが、ホームディレクトリをルートにしたくない。同時に、割り当てと割り当てワークスペースの両方で内容が重複することは望ましくありません。何かのようなもの

jagat ~/assignments $ git init && git remote add origin <git_url> && git add -A .
jagat ~/assignments $ git commit -m "Stuff from assignments" && git push origin master
jagat ~/assignments $ cd ../assign-workspace/
jagat ~/assign-workspace $ git init && git remote add origin <git_url> && git add -A .
jagat ~/assign-workspace $ git commit -m "Stuff from assign-workspace" && git push origin master

最終的に、assigns および assign-workspace の下のすべてのディレクトリは、同じリポジトリの下で管理する必要があります。両方を別のディレクトリ「assignments_all」の下に置くことをお勧めします。これは既に行っています。

さて、そもそもそれができるかどうか、私はただ興味があります。

4

2 に答える 2

2

解決策の 1 つは、新しいディレクトリを作成し、そのディレクトリの下に git で管理したい両方のディレクトリを配置し、そこにリポジトリを作成することです。

次に、ホーム ディレクトリからそれらのディレクトリへのシンボリック リンクを作成します。

于 2013-05-27T18:13:00.507 に答える
1

ありえない。git は ~/assignments/README と ~/assign-workspace/README の違いをどのように認識しますか?

于 2013-05-27T18:37:02.553 に答える